WebSep 17, 2024 · Common wisdom says that the average length of a familial generation is four generations per century, but this length can vary depending on many factors. One of the most defining factors is the country’s level of development. Families in developed countries usually have a high 20s to 30-year gap between generations. (Which, technically, I suppose we have, given how … florida restaurant with live gatorWebMay 6, 2024 · How Many Years is 10 Generations? Again, it depends on what the accepted number of years that a generation is.
